QPR vs Blackburn Rovers Tips & Preview - Hosts to maintain home form
- QPR aiming for the top 10, eyeing a promotion playoff spot.
- QPR strong at home, five wins in last six home games.
- Blackburn struggling on the road, winless in last four.

QPR vs Blackburn Rovers
QPR are pushing for a place in the top 10 and welcome Blackburn Rovers to Loftus Road for an English Championship fixture on Tuesday.
The visitors are in the mix for a promotion playoff place but have been below their best lately, particularly on the road. The hosts are often solid in front of their fans and should have the edge in this one.
QPR Form
Sitting 14th in the table, the immediate task for QPR will be to push for a place in the top 10. With just six points separating them from sixth-placed West Brom, a promotion playoff place is also not beyond reach.
QPR have stumbled slightly lately, losing their last two Championship matches and were beaten 2-1 at Millwall last Saturday. However, they had picked up four straight wins prior to those defeats and the good news for manager Marti Cifuentes is that the Hoops have also won five of their last six Championship matches at Loftus Road.
One issue for QPR is a vulnerability at the back having failed to keep a clean sheet in nine of their last 10 Championship matches. However, they have scored in seven of their last eight Championship home matches while five fixtures in that run have produced over 2.5 goals.
Blackburn Rovers Form
Blackburn Rovers travel to Loftus Road off the back of a 2-1 victory over Preston North End in their previous Championship fixture. However, that win comes after three straight defeats as John Eustace’s men have found things difficult lately.
One of the things hampering Blackburn Rovers is a dodgy defence that has failed to keep a clean sheet in the last four Championship matches. They try to strike a balance going forward and have scored in three of their last five matches in the league.
Blackburn Rovers have also been poor on their travels and are winless in their last four Championship away matches. They have been beaten three times in that run, with a 2-1 defeat to 16th-placed Bristol City among their results.
Head to Head
Blackburn Rovers have the upper hand in recent meetings with QPR and have won five of the last six matches. The visitors claimed a 2-0 home victory in the reverse fixture back in September.
Verdict
Blackburn Rovers may have a good record in this fixture but do not come into Tuesday’s clash in good form. QPR, on the other hand, have done some of their best work at home in the last few matches and should claim the win here.
Neither defence has been solid this season and both teams are expected to score here while a win for the host should produce an outcome of over 2.5 goals.
